Ingredients
The ingredient list is short, but each one plays an important role in building the flavor and look of the drink. This is what makes it such an easy go to.
- 1.5 oz white rum
- 8 oz pink lemonade
- Lemon slices for garnish
- Strawberries for garnish
- Pink or yellow Peeps bunny marshmallow for garnish
White rum keeps the drink light and clean, so it blends well with the lemonade instead of overpowering it. Pink lemonade gives the cocktail its color and tangy sweetness, making it refreshing and easy to sip.
The garnishes are where the fun comes in. Lemon slices and strawberries add a fresh touch, while the Peeps marshmallow gives the drink its playful look.

How to Make It
This cocktail is all about simplicity. You can have it ready in just a couple of minutes.
- Fill the Glass
Add ice to a highball or rocks glass. - Mix the Cocktail
Pour in the pink lemonade and white rum. Stir gently to combine. - Garnish
Add a lemon wedge, a fresh strawberry, and Pink or yellow Peeps bunny marshmallow on the rim or float it on top. - Serve
Enjoy immediately while cold.
You can adjust the ratio slightly depending on how strong or light you want your drink.
Pro Tips
Even though this drink is simple, a few small details can make it even better.
- Use chilled lemonade to keep the drink cold longer
- Add fresh ice right before serving to avoid dilution
- Choose ripe strawberries for better flavor
- Stir gently so you do not lose carbonation if using sparkling lemonade
- Taste and adjust if you want it stronger or lighter
- Try freezing strawberries to use as ice cubes
- Use clear ice for a cleaner look
These little touches can make a simple cocktail feel more polished.

Storage and Serving Notes
This drink is best served fresh, but you can still prep a few things ahead of time.
You can slice your garnishes and chill your lemonade in advance. When you are ready to serve, just add ice, pour, and stir.
If you are making a large batch, mix the lemonade and rum in a pitcher and keep it in the fridge. Add ice to individual glasses when serving so the drink does not get watered down.
Serve right away for the best taste and temperature.
